Washington, D.C., the capital of the United States, is a vibrant city steeped in history, politics, and culture. Located along the Potomac River, it serves as the heart of the nation's government, home to iconic landmarks such as the White House, Capitol Building, and Supreme Court. The National Mall, a sprawling park, hosts monuments like the Lincoln Memorial and Washington Monument, symbolizing the country's heritage. Beyond its political significance, D.C. boasts world-class museums, including the Smithsonian Institution, and a thriving arts scene. Diverse neighborhoods like Georgetown and Adams Morgan offer unique dining, shopping, and entertainment experiences. With its blend of historical importance and modern vitality, Washington, D.C., is a dynamic destination that reflects the spirit of the United States.
